Job Description

About the role:

As a Manufacturing Associate, you will perform routine and critical manufacturing operations, including work functions in Cell Culture, Purification, Solution & Equipment Prep areas. Operate production equipment according to SOPs for producing clinical and commercial products. You will report to the Supervisor, Manufacturing.

How you will contribute:
  • Troubleshoot and resolve basic process related issues recognizing and escalating deviations
  • Implement critical and routine activities in support of production
  • Perform Batch Record, Log Book and Form Prep requests
  • Enter data in the Laboratory Information Management System (LIMS), MODA, or other business functions
  • Review GMP documentation
  • Sample preparation and testing
  • Identify changes needed to document
  • Participate in tiered visual management system and support CI plans
  • Initiate work orders
  • Assemble and disassemble of process equipment
  • Perform scheduled cleaning of equipment and standardization of equipment
  • Support change over activities

    Develop equipment and process qualifications and validation

Important Considerations:

At Takeda, our patients rely on us to deliver quality products. As a result, we must follow strict rules in our manufacturing facilities to ensure we are not endangering the quality of the product. You may:

  • Work in a controlled environment requiring special gowning and wear protective clothing over the head, face, hands, feet and body. This may include additional hearing protection for loud areas
  • Need to remove all make-up, jewelry, contact lenses, nail polish or artificial fingernails while in the manufacturing environment
  • Work in a cold, wet environment
  • Work multiple shifts, including weekends, or we will ask you to work supplemental hours on occasion
  • Work around chemicals such as alcohol, acids, buffers and Celite that may require respiratory protection
  • May require you to adjust your work schedule to meet production demands
  • Ability to lift, pull, or push equipment requiring up to 25-50 lbs. of force.
  • Ability to stand for 6 hours in production suite.
  • Ability to climb ladders and work platforms
  • Stooping and bending to check or troubleshoot equipment operations
  • May require weekend or holiday off shift support
